New York Gov. Kathy Hochul announced an agreement late Thursday to end a wildcat strike that has roiled the state’s prison system for more than a week.
Hochul said the mediated settlement addresses many of the workers’ concerns, puts the state prison system on the path to safe operations and prevents future unsanctioned work stoppages.
